Crystal Structure of Cu(II)(Sal-Leu)/apo-Myoglobin

OverviewOverview

apo-Myoglobin (apo-Mb) was reconstituted with three copper complexes:, CuII(Sal-Phe) (1; Sal-Phe = N-salicylidene-l-phenylalanato), CuII(Sal-Leu), (2; Sal-Leu = N-salicylidene-l-leucinato), and CuII(Sal-Ala) (3; Sal-Ala =, N-salicylidene-l-alanato). The crystal structures of 1.apo-Mb (1.65 A, resolution) and 2.apo-Mb (1.8 A resolution) show that the coordination, geometry around the CuII atom in apo-Mb is distorted square-planar with, tridentate Sal-X and a Nepsilon atom of His64 in the apo-Mb cavity and the, plane of these copper complexes is perpendicular to that of heme. These, results suggest that the apo-Mb cavity can hold metal complexes with, various coordination geometries.
